Synopsis

Daniel Mason was born and raised in Northern California. He studied Biology at Harvard, and Medicine at the University of California, in San Francisco. His first novel, The Piano Tuner , published in 2002, was a national bestseller and has since been published in 27 countries. Daniel has also published a short story in Harper's , on the life of the artist Arthur Bispo de Rosario. His new novel, A Far Country , was published by Knopf in March, 2007. Currently, he lives in the San Francisco Bay Area, where he is at work on his third book.
